python面向对象中的私有属性和私有化方法
xx: 公有变量 (公有)_x: 单前置下划线,私有化属性或方法,from somemodule import *禁止导入,类对象和子类可以访问__xx:双前置下划线,避免与子类中的属性命名冲突,无法在外部直接访问(名字重整所以访问不到) (私有)xx:双前后下划线,用户名字空间的魔法对象或属性。例如:init, __ 不要自己发明这样的名字xx_:单后置下划线,用于避免与Python关键词的冲....
Python 面向对象3:私有属性和私有方法
一、 应用场景及定义方式1.1、应用场景在实际开发中,对象 的 某些属性或方法 可能只希望 在对象的内部被使用,而 不希望在外部被访问到私有属性 就是 对象 不希望公开的 属性私有方法 就是 对象 不希望公开的 方法1.2、定义方式在 定义属性或方法时,在 属性名或者方法名前 增加 两个下划线,定义的就是 私有 属性或方法,self.__age = 18就是私有属性,而self.age = 18....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Python面向对象相关内容
- Python编程面向对象
- Python学习面向对象编程
- Python类面向对象
- 面向对象Python
- Python面向对象特性
- Python面向对象脚本语言
- Python面向对象简介
- Python面向对象多态
- Python面向对象方法
- Python面向对象继承
- Python面向对象封装继承多态
- Python面向对象oop
- Python类面向对象编程
- Python面向对象编程对象
- Python面向对象浅拷贝
- Python面向对象类
- Python面向对象编程实战
- Python面向对象__init__
- Python大数据面向对象
- Python学生管理系统面向对象
- Python面向对象编程super
- Python面向对象案例
- Python面向对象人狗大战
- Python面向对象异常
- Python面向对象拓展
- Python面向对象概念
- Python面向对象异常处理
- Python面向对象编程应用
- Python面向对象学习
- Python面向对象入门
Python更多面向对象相关
- Python面向对象对象方法
- Python面向对象继承属性
- Python面向对象特征
- Python面向对象元类
- Python面向对象实战飞机大战
- 软件测试Python面向对象
- Python面向对象程序设计
- Python面向对象鸭子
- Python学习笔记面向对象
- Python面向对象静态方法
- Python基础面向对象
- Python面向对象进阶
- Python面向对象编程实例变量
- Python面向对象属性
- Python基础面向对象基本概念
- Python面向对象单例模式
- Python基础面向对象编程
- Python面向对象基础
- Python面向对象继承特点
- Python面向对象基础类和对象
- Python面向对象编程进阶
- Python面向对象编程反射hasattr getattr
- Python面向对象编程str
- Python面向对象编程repr
- 整理Python面向对象编程案例收藏
- Python面向对象基础语法
- Python面向对象类属性实例属性
- Python面向对象理解
- Python面向对象核心类型
- Python学习笔记面向对象编程